Waste Sorting Equipment

Waste sorting equipment refers to a range of machinery used to separate and sort different types of waste materials. This equipment employs various technologies like conveyor belts, sensors, magnets, and air classifiers to segregate recyclables such as paper, plastic, glass, and metal from non-recyclable waste, reducing the amount of material that ends up in landfills.


Plastic Shredder Machine

A plastic shredder machine is designed to reduce plastic waste into smaller, more manageable pieces. The shredder uses sharp blades or cutters to break down plastic objects like bottles, containers, and other plastic items, making it easier to recycle or process the plastic material for reuse in manufacturing.


Baling Machine

A baling machine is a device used to compress and bind various types of materials into compact bales. These materials can include recyclable waste such as cardboard, paper, plastic, metal, and other materials. Baling machines are crucial for waste management as they facilitate efficient storage, transportation, and recycling of waste materials.


Waste Baler

A waste baler is a mechanical machine used to compress and bind different types of waste materials into dense and compact bales. These materials can include recyclables like cardboard, paper, plastics, aluminum cans, and other non-recyclable waste. The primary purpose of a waste baler is to reduce the volume of waste, making it more efficient and cost-effective for storage, transportation, and disposal.


Waste balers come in various sizes and configurations, ranging from small vertical balers used in businesses or retail stores to large horizontal balers commonly found in recycling centers and waste management facilities. The baler compresses the waste materials by applying pressure from hydraulic or mechanical systems, and once the desired density is achieved, it wraps the bale with twine, wire, or straps to hold it securely together.


By using a waste baler, companies and organizations can minimize the space occupied by waste, reduce the frequency of waste collections, and lower overall waste disposal costs. Moreover, baled recyclable materials are easier to handle and transport, contributing to more sustainable waste management practices and promoting recycling efforts.


Cardboard Baler

A cardboard baler is a specialized type of waste baler designed specifically for compressing and baling cardboard materials. Cardboard is one of the most common types of recyclable waste generated by businesses, supermarkets, retail stores, and households. Cardboard balers play a crucial role in waste management and recycling efforts, as they help to efficiently process and recycle large volumes of cardboard waste.


The compacted cardboard bales are then easy to handle, store, and transport, reducing storage space requirements and transportation costs. These bales are typically sent to recycling facilities, where they are processed and used to manufacture new cardboard products, contributing to a more sustainable and circular economy.


Semi Automatic Waste Baler

A semi-automatic waste baler is a type of baling machine designed to compress and bundle various types of waste materials into compact bales. Unlike fully automatic balers, semi-automatic balers require some manual intervention from operators during the baling process. Typically, the process involves manually loading the waste materials into the baler's chamber.

Once the waste materials are loaded, the semi-automatic baler takes over and automatically applies hydraulic or mechanical pressure to compress the materials into tightly packed bales. After compression, the baler will usually prompt the operator to tie off or secure the bale with twine, wire, or straps manually. Once the bale is tied, it can be ejected from the chamber, and the baler is ready for the next baling cycle.


Semi-automatic waste balers offer a balance between human control and automated efficiency. They are suitable for facilities with moderate waste volumes that may not require the full automation of the baling process. These balers are often used in businesses, recycling centers, and smaller waste management operations.


Automatic Waste Baler

An automatic waste baler is a fully automated baling machine that handles the entire baling process without requiring manual intervention from operators. These balers are designed to optimize efficiency and productivity in waste management operations with high waste volumes.

In an automatic waste baler, waste materials are automatically fed into the baler's chamber using conveyors, sensors, or other automated systems. The baler then applies hydraulic or mechanical pressure to compress the materials into compact bales. Once the desired density is achieved, the baler automatically ties off or secures the bale with twine, wire, or straps.


After securing the bale, the automatic baler ejects it from the chamber and is ready to begin the next baling cycle without the need for human assistance. This level of automation makes automatic waste balers ideal for large-scale waste management facilities and recycling centers that handle significant waste volumes.


Both semi-automatic and automatic waste balers play essential roles in waste management by reducing waste volume, facilitating recycling efforts, and optimizing storage and transportation of waste materials. The choice between the two types of balers depends on the specific needs and waste volumes of the facility using them.
